Transaction 05868efee5d3fb07fa1bf0db1100e83e17ae0bc1b1636510cc3650f62d9969ff

1 Input
2 Outputs
  • 05868efee5d3fb07fa1bf0db1100e83e17ae0bc1b1636510cc3650f62d9969ff:0
  • value  2704242293
    address  2MuyHEdo3dkWAAxbwZ9w7ALa4Xx5T7N8KiE
  • 05868efee5d3fb07fa1bf0db1100e83e17ae0bc1b1636510cc3650f62d9969ff:1
  • value  211000000
    address  2N6Hv5LYN1Xy9GmfBsC2G2iuWQEQvWv5csu